Enel Green Power (Italy) plans €6.1bn investment by 2018

Enel Green Power has presented its 2014-2018 Business Plan, which targets €6.1bn in capital expenditures, including €5.4bn for growth. By 2018, Enel's subsidiary aims to add 4.6 GW (of which 1 GW should be installed before the end of 2014) in order to reach an installed capacity of 13.4 GW (including decommissioning) and an average power generation of 45 TWh in 2018. Enel Green Power plans to raise its installed capacity in Europe by 1 GW, from 6 GW in 2013, to reach 6.9 GW installed in 2018 (including 0.1 GW of decommissioning); the group will invest more than €1bn in Europe to reach this goal. In North America, the group aims to add 700 MW to raise its capacity from 1.7 GW in 2013 to 2.4 GW in 2018, with €610m of investments. Enel Green Power will also focus on emerging markets (Uruguay, Ecuador, Kenya, Egypt, Saudi Arabia and Russia, in addition to the 16 countries in which Enel Green Power currently operates and the new countries already announced, namely Colombia, Peru, Turkey, South Africa and Morocco); the group will invest more than €4.4bn in emerging markets by 2018, including €2.8bn in Latin America. Enel Green Power plans to add 2.9 GW to its existing 1.2 GW capacity, to reach 4.1 GW installed in emerging markets in 2018.
